### What is Copper Foil Tape?

Copper foil tape consists of a thin layer of copper foil coated with an adhesive layer. This adhesive could be both conductive or non-conductive depending upon the supposed use. The tape is adaptable, quick to use, and might be soldered, rendering it suited to electrical and electromagneticCopper Tape Conductive Adhesive shielding duties in addition to crafting.

### Kinds of Copper Tape and Adhesives

| Kind | Description | Typical Utilizes |
|------------------------------|-----------------------------------------------------------------------------------------------|-----------------------------------------|
| **Conductive Copper Tape** | Copper tape having a conductive adhesive that allows electrical present-day to go through the adhesive layer. | EMI shielding, grounding, static elimination. |
| **Copper Tape with Non-Conductive Adhesive** | Adhesive isn't going to conduct electricity; conduction only through copper foil. | Cable wrapping, masking, attractive employs. |
| **Double-Sided Copper Tape** | Copper foil coated with conductive adhesive on both sides, allowing present-day stream on the two surfaces. | Complex grounding and soldering purposes. |
| **Adhesive Copper Foil Tape**| Copper foil by using a sticky backing, obtainable in conductive or non-conductive adhesive forms. | Normal electronics, stained glass, crafts. |

### Essential Attributes of Conductive Copper Foil Tape

- **Fantastic Electrical Conductivity:** Copper’s normal conductivity is enhanced by conductive adhesives that manage electrical continuity[1][two][4].
- **Solderability:** Most copper tapes are meant to be solderable, making it possible for secure electrical connections for circuits and repairs[two][four].
- **Temperature Resistance:** Normal tapes withstand temperatures from about -10°C up to one hundred twenty-155°C, suited to electronics and industrial environments[1][4][five].
- **Flexibility and Toughness:** Copper foil tape is thin and flexible, conforming to irregular surfaces while keeping durability[1][seven].
- **Shielding Effectiveness:** Utilised thoroughly for electromagnetic interference (EMI) shielding and electrostatic discharge (ESD) safety in Digital devices[1][nine].

### Common Programs

- **EMI/RFI Shielding:** Copper foil tape is utilized to shield electronic parts, cables, and enclosures from electromagnetic interference, ensuring unit general performance and compliance with rules[one][nine].
- **Grounding and Static Elimination:** Conductive adhesive copper tape offers a path to floor static rates in sensitive electronic assemblies[9][ten].
- **Soldering and Repairs:** The tape serves as an excellent surface area for soldering in circuit repairs or developing connections in Do it yourself electronics and stained glass art[2][5].
- **Capacitive Touch Sensors:** Its conductive Houses make it beneficial in developing contact-delicate pads as well as other sensing programs[2].
- **Cable Wrapping and Masking:** Shields cables and factors from interference and provides insulation in assembly processes[1][7].

### Well-known Measurements and Requirements

- Widths usually range between 5mm to 45mm, with lengths from ten to thirty meters or more, according to the supplier[1][4][7].
- Thickness normally all around 0.03mm (30μm) to 0.07mm (70μm), balancing overall flexibility with toughness[four][10].
- Adhesion power varies but usually gives sturdy bonding suited to Digital parts and industrial use[1][10].

### Selecting the Proper Copper Tape

When picking copper foil tape, take into account:

- **Adhesive Variety:** Conductive adhesive for electrical continuity or non-conductive for easy shielding.
- **Tape Thickness and Width:** Determined by the appliance spot and suppleness necessary.
- **Temperature and Environmental Resistance:** For high-temperature or outdoor purposes, pick out tapes rated appropriately.
- **Double-Sided vs. Solitary-Sided:** Double-sided conductive tapes permit existing movement on both sides, useful for elaborate grounding[three][5].
